Full Job Description
Location: Bethesda, MD

Category: Software Engineer
Travel Required: No
Remote Type: Hybrid
Clearance: TS/SCI

As an Elastic Search Engineer, you'll be a member of our platform engineering team and help develop, deploy and maintain nosql databases as foundational elements of our microservice eco-system using a Kubernetes as foundational platform. You'll also support the adoption of GitOps best practices across cross-functional engineering teams. In this fast-paced environment, you'll collaborate closely with systems engineering, architecture, development, security, operations, and integrations teams.

Work is conducted on-site at our client location in Bethesda, MD.

Key Responsibilities Include:

Deploy, triage, debug, and maintain production class databases like Elasticsearch and Redis
Design and support database configuration management strategies across air-gapped network fabrics
Partner with Systems Engineers to architect solutions for new capabilities
Contribute to operational monitoring capabilities to provide proactive system notifications
Contribute technical input to engineering documentation, diagrams, and models
Participate in Agile release planning, scrums, design sessions, bug triage, and related team activities

To be successful in this role you need (required):
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related technical field (or equivalent experience) with 8+ years of relevant experience; Master's degree with 6+ years of experience.
  • Active TS/SCI security clearance with the ability to obtain and maintain a Polygraph.
  • Current DoD 8570.01M IAT Level II (or higher) certification, such as Security+, CySA+, SSCP, CCNA Security, or CISSP (or Associate).
  • Ability to obtain and maintain Privileged User Account (PUA) certification.
  • Experience with Kubernetes and container platforms such as EKS, Rancher, or RKE2.
  • Experience with one or more of the following: Elasticsearch, Keycloak, Redis, Strimzi.
  • Experience working with open-source technologies and modern infrastructure platforms.
  • Experience hardening databases to comply with NIST 800-53 security controls.
  • Strong knowledge of Linux system administration.
  • Experience deploying, managing, and troubleshooting containerized applications.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to collaborate effectively with customers, engineers, architects, and cross-functional teams.
  • Comfortable working in a fast-paced environment with team members from diverse technical backgrounds.
